    Default A Question For You Skateboarders

    What are some decent, cheap, long-lasting wheels for a casual skateboarder that'd I might find at the local bike and board shop?

    And also some trucks with similar qualities.

    K so
    if you just wanna cruise, like no powerslides, tricks etc
    just go with your local shop's wheels, or buy any WHEEL BRAND, as in don't buy any wheels that are made by a company that mainly makes something else (like element or girl), do some research and check it out
    for trucks, same thing, but most likely, if its available, just buy your shop's branded trucks/wheels
